How is the strength of a volcanic eruption related to the magma in the volcano?A.The strength of the eruption is determined by the depth of the magma below the volcano.B.If the magma is more viscous, the eruption is stronger.C.The more magma the volcano contains, the more slowly it will erupt.D.They are not relate
Solution
The strength of a volcanic eruption is indeed related to the magma in the volcano. Here's how:
A. The depth of the magma below the volcano can influence the strength of the eruption, but it's not the only factor. The pressure build-up from the depth can cause a more explosive eruption when the magma finally reaches the surface.
B. The viscosity of the magma plays a significant role in the strength of the eruption. More viscous magma tends to trap gases, leading to a build-up of pressure that can result in a more explosive eruption.
C. The amount of magma in the volcano can influence the duration of the eruption, but not necessarily the strength. A large volume of magma can lead to a longer-lasting eruption, but the strength of the eruption is more related to the gas content and viscosity of the magma.
D. The statement that the strength of a volcanic eruption and the magma in the volcano are not related is incorrect. As explained above, several aspects of the magma (such as its depth, viscosity, and gas content) can significantly influence the strength of the eruption.
